Understanding Storefront Glazing
Storefront glazing refers to the glass elements of a structure's facade, particularly in commercial settings. It encompasses windows, glass doors, and in some cases glass walls that comprise the entryway or display screen locations of retail and other public-facing services. The choice of glazing materials can significantly influence not just the appearance of a storefront but also its total efficiency.
Kinds Of Storefront Glazing
Single Glazing:
Consists of one layer of glass.Normally less energy-efficient.Often used in older structures.
Double Glazing:
Features two layers of glass with an insulating space in between.Offers better thermal insulation and soundproofing.Frequently used in contemporary storefronts.
Triple Glazing:
Incorporates three layers of glass.Provides optimum insulation and energy efficiency.Best matched for extremely cold environments.
Low-E Glass:
Coated with a special movie that reflects UV rays and decreases heat loss.Helps maintain comfortable indoor temperature levels.Ideal for energy-conscious companies.
Tempered Glass:
Heat-treated to be more powerful than basic glass.Shatters into little, safer pieces when broken.Often utilized in high-traffic areas for included security.
Laminated Glass:

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: What is the distinction between double and triple glazing?
A1: Double glazing includes two layers of glass, while triple glazing consists of three layers. Triple glazing provides better thermal insulation, making it more energy-efficient.
Q2: How does low-E glass work?
A2: Low-E glass has an unique covering that shows heat and blocks UV rays, assisting to control indoor temperature levels and safeguard furniture from sun damage.
Q3: Is tempered glass required for all stores?
A3: While not obligatory for all stores, tempered glass is advised for locations where safety is essential, such as entranceways or high-traffic places.
